размещение сообщения с моего сайта на стене Facebook - PullRequest
1 голос
/ 10 октября 2011

Я пытаюсь опубликовать сообщение на стене Facebook.Я попытался с developer.facebok и settigns в том запросе на сайт, на который я должен ссылаться. На самом деле я работаю на локальном сейчас, и сайт не опубликован на сервере.как я могу опубликовать на стене в фейсбуке мой местный мехин.

    var body = 'Reading Connect JS documentation'; 
    FB.api('/me/feed', 'post', { message: body }, function(response) 
    { 
        if (!response || response.error) 
        { 
            alert('Error occured'); 
        } 
        else 
        { 
            alert('Post ID: ' + response.id); 
        } 
    }); 

1 Ответ

0 голосов
/ 06 января 2012

Я бы рекомендовал предупреждать response.error вместо статической строки или устанавливать отладчик;укажите там и посмотрите на значение.

Также посмотрите на сетевой трафик и проверьте поток ответов, если они не работают.

Чтобы публиковать сообщения на стене даже после того, как пользователь оставил вашприложение (но все еще оставляет разрешения, принятые для publish_stream), тогда вы можете просто использовать свой идентификатор приложения / секрет, чтобы публиковать их.От https://developers.facebook.com/docs/reference/api/permissions/

Позволяет вашему приложению публиковать контент, комментарии и лайки в потоке пользователя и в потоках его друзей.С этим разрешением вы можете публиковать контент в фиде пользователя в любое время, не требуя offline_access.Тем не менее, обратите внимание, что Facebook рекомендует модель совместного использования, инициированную пользователем.

...